zoukankan      html  css  js  c++  java
  • java继承 子类重写父类方法

    package com.addd;
    
    //多态
    public class Sld {
    	private String name = "zhangsan";
    
    	public Sld() {
    		aaa();//方法里面可放方法。
    
    		User(name);
    	}
    
    	public void aaa() {
    		System.out.println("父类1号" + name);
    	}
    
    	public void User(String a) {
    
    		System.out.println("父类2号" + name);
    	}
    }
    
    class Dd extends Sld {
    	private String name = "son";
    
    	public Dd() {
    		aaa();
    		User(name);
    	}
    
    	public void aaa() {
    		System.out.println("子类1号" + name);// 子类重写了父类的方法,父类就不会用了,就是子类用。所以。son
    	}
    
    	public void User(String name) {
    		System.out.println("子类2号 :" + name);
    	}
    }
    
    
    
    
    
    package com.addd;
    
    public class Zl {
    	public static void main(String[] args) {
    		
    		//Sld s=new Dd();
    		//s.aaa();
    		Sld m=new Dd();
    	
    		
    		
    	}
    
    }
    
    
    
    
    
    
    子类1号null
    子类2号 :zhangsan
    子类1号son
    子类2号 :son
    

      

    总结:多态。方法,好重要

  • 相关阅读:
    Friends ZOJ
    2^x mod n = 1 HDU
    Paint the Grid Reloaded ZOJ
    Treap 模板
    bzoj进度条
    。。。
    bzoj
    。。。
    bzoj
    题解continue
  • 原文地址:https://www.cnblogs.com/langlove/p/3439584.html
Copyright © 2011-2022 走看看